What “medication-related night sweats” really means

Night sweats are episodes of sweating that disrupt sleep, often enough to require changing clothes or bedding. They can happen with a normal bedroom temperature and may arrive in waves, much like a hot flash, or as a steady, clammy overheating that builds after you fall asleep.

Medications can trigger this in a few ways: by shifting how your brain regulates temperature, by changing blood vessel tone (making you flush), by changing hormone signals, or by pushing metabolism a bit higher than your body prefers at night.

If you are dealing with night sweats plus fever, unexplained weight loss, chest pain, severe shortness of breath, or drenching sweats that are new and intense, get medical guidance promptly. A medication side effect is common, but it is not the only possibility.

Why some medications make your body run hot at night

Your core temperature normally drops at night to support deeper sleep. Many drugs nudge the thermostat controls in the hypothalamus or alter autonomic signaling that governs sweating.

How to talk with your clinician without losing momentum

The goal is comfort and safety, not simply “stop the drug.” Many people can reduce night sweats with a dose adjustment, a timing change, a switch within the same class, or by treating a compounding factor like thyroid level or blood sugar variability.

Also ask one very practical question: whether taking the medication earlier in the day is appropriate. For some drugs, bedtime dosing can intensify nighttime side effects. For others, timing is clinically important, so you want tailored advice.

Why airflow under the covers matters more than most people expect

Many “hot sleepers” are not overheating because the whole room is hot. They are overheating because heat gets trapped in bedding. Your body warms the air inside that cocoon, the warm air stays put, and sweat becomes your backup cooling system.

A ceiling fan or box fan can make the room feel nicer, yet it often fails to fix the microclimate under the sheets where the heat is actually building.

Targeted bed cooling focuses on the trapped zone: moving air into the bedding space so warm, humid air does not stagnate around your skin.

A simple 7-night experiment to pinpoint what helps most

You can learn a lot in one week without changing your prescription. Track only two numbers: “sweat severity” (0 to 5) and “wakeups” (count). Keep it quick.

Night 1 to 2: lighten bedding and switch to breathable fabrics.
Night 3 to 4: add pre-bed cool-down and reduce evening triggers.
Night 5 to 7: add targeted airflow under the sheet, keeping the bedroom a bit warmer than usual to test whether personal cooling is enough.

Bring that mini-log to your next appointment. It turns a vague complaint into usable clinical information, and it also helps you feel progress even while you work through medication decisions at a safe pace.
